The '''Reckoners''' are a group of freedom fighters on [[Earth (Reckoners)|Earth]]. They fight the tyranny of the [[Epic]]s.{{book ref|Steelheart|1}}

Founded and lead by [[Jonathan Phaedrus]](also known as Prof), they seek to neutralise as many high-profile Epics as they can. They employ stealth, trickery, and careful planning to overcome their vastly more powerful opponents. They explicitly avoid labeling themselves as revolutionaries; their goal is simply to bring retribution upon the worst Epics, not to rule in their place. They use advanced technology (as well as epic-based ones) and meticulous planning to take down Epics. They are also responsible for freeing the cities of [[Newcago]], [[Babilar]], and [[Ildithia]].

They operate as many "cells", while the core cell lead by Prof does the killing, the other cells mainly provides information and assists with the scouting or logistics.{{cite}} The lesser cells are mostly kept secret from the epic-based technologies they use. In case people in any cell get captured, Prof keeps all information about the other cells secret.{{Book ref|Lux|13}}
